Sat Dec 1st 2007 

Holyhead 1 Ruthin Town 0 

Ruthin were again involved in a tight encounter with one of the leagues top sides, if you asked anybody were you wouldn't like to play with gales forecast Holyhead would be high up the list. 

Throughout the afternoon what felt like a force 9 gale howled from one end to the other.

Ruthin lost the toss and played with the wind in the first half it was very difficult for both sides and it was pretty even throughout Holyhead and Ruthin both tried to keep the ball on the ground and played some entertaining football when the ball could be kept on the pitch. Ruthin tried a number of pot shots from 30 yards plus from Liam Jones, Gary Ellison and Dave Holloway that the Holyhead keeper probably used to these conditions dealt with competently.

Curt Williams occassionally looked dangerous but the Ruthin back 4 performed well. 

At half time Ruthin were asked to continue playing the ball on the ground and try and push forward into the gale. Within 2 minutes of the second half Holyhead scored the crucial first goal Mike Edwards inswinging corner assisted by the elements went directly in. Ruthin knuckled down well and tried to play football chances for both sides were scarce the main danger from Holyhead been a series of excellent corners from Mike Edwards that Llyr Williams did well to deal with.

With 17 minutes to go Ruthin introduced Si Holloway for Matthew Davies with Will Roberts moving into midfield this rejuvenated Ruthin and they began to push Holyhead back with some excellent football. Liam Jones fired wide from a free kick from just outside the box, and Sam Cartwright put in a great cross for the Holyhead keeper to just foil Gary Ellison. 

Again it was a case of a gallant defeat for Ruthin against good opposition if they continue to play like this the breaks will eventually come.

Sat Nov 24h 2007 

Ruthin Town 2 Llandudno 2 

In a terrific tussle Ruthin eventually prized a point from in form Llandudno. Ruthin squad featuring 7 of their current U19s squad more than matched their opponents. A tight but entertaining first half with a high degree of midfield action Rooney in the Llandudno goal was the busier of the goalkeepers making notable saves from Gary Ellison and Garmon Hafal. Llandudno were first to break the deadlock with a 34th minutes goal from Jody Hamilton the goal stemmed from a strong run by the Llandudno right back who ran 30 yards past a number of weak challenges by Ruthin players, the ball was crossed to the far post where Hamilton rose to nod home. Just before half time Garmon Hafal limped off with a knee injury hopefully following recent knee problems this was purely down to being injured in a tackle. He was replaced by Sam Cartwright.  
The second half followed a similar pattern with Ellison again prominent but the real danger was coming from Sam Cartwirght the 16 year old showed great pace, touch and a real willingness to track back. Ruthin substituted Garmon Rhys for Matthew Davies on 55 minutes Davies going wide right and Sam Cartwright moving over to wide left. In fact it was this partnership that got Ruthin back into the game a tremendous cross from the right by Davies evaded all the Llandudno defence and Sam Cartwright slid the ball into the empty net. 
On 75 minutes Llandudno scored through Joe Morgan following a goal mouth scramble after a corner, again Ruthin have to be disappointed with their defending. On 80 minutes Rob Lewis came on to replace the injured John Jones. Ruthin kept plugging away with Rooney again the busier of the keepers, with a few minutes to go Will Roberts was pushed up front with Aled Roberts moving from the back four into midfield.
With 96 minutes on the clock it seemed all but over Gary Ellison had possession on the wide right he put in a left footed cross that Dave Holloway and Will Roberts went to meet but everybody including the excellent Rooney missed the ball which went straight in, queue wild celebrations from Ruthin.

It was a well deserved point from a never say die Ruthin side.

Sat Nov 10th 2007 

Mynydd Isa 1 Ruthin Town 0 

A depleted Ruthin squad put up a spirited performance only to lose out to a poor decision by a linesman and a goal in the last 5 minutes at a windy Mynydd Isa. The treatment table at Ruthin is currently busier than the training ground with no less than 9 1st team squad members injured it is very frustrating but the  encouraging fact is that whilst not getting great results Ruthin continue to compete at this level and can't wait for the return to fitness of some of the injury list.
Playing with the wind in the first half Ruthin were slow to start MI probed but rarely tested Jez Porter. As they warmed to the task Ruthin began to string passes together with the competitive Gaz Martin prominent, the bigger MI side played a more direct route one game. On 35 minutes a MI midfielder was sent off for trying to cut Gaz Martin in half with a 'tasty' challenge. 
The ten men of MI held out to half time, with the strengthening wind into their faces in the second half Ruthin struggled to get the ball up to the forwards and MI again rarely threatened to score. On 65 mintues a great cross from SI Holloway, on for the tiring Gaz Martin, was headed across goal by Dave Holloway for Gary Ellison to head in or so they thought the MI keeper clearly behind the line scooped the ball out and the linesman in a perfect position made no move or decision. The MI goalkeeper was happy to report after the match that the ball was at least 2 feet over the line! 
Ruthin continued to probe but the game was petering out as with 5 minutes to go the same linesman incorrectly gave a throw to MI near Ruthins box the ball was knocked on from the throw and MI gratefully scored from a 6 yard header. 
With 3 minutes to go Dave Holloway was held by the throat and the MI midfielder was sent off the referee booked Dave presumably for attacking the opponents fist with his throat but later realised he had already booked him therefore had to send him off, this prompted further meyhem and on the final whistle Simon Holloway was given a straight red card for foolishly questioning the officials judgement. The subsequent suspensions mean Ruthin will have a complete CA team out of action over the next few weeks.
Ruthins young squad continue to learn the hard way but learn they will.
